FMCW-Radarsignalverarbeitung zur Entfernungsmessung mit hoher Genauigkeit
Distance measurements with micrometer accuracies are essential for the control of industrial machines. This work investigates the maximum possible accuracy of FMCW radar systems, which use an additional phase evaluation.
